Finance Review — Project Lanternfield. Summary for sales leads: the internal CRM migration at Corvane Systems is delayed two quarters. Integration testing with the Marlow billing platform failed acceptance twice; contractor costs are running 22% over estimate. Near-term impact: pipeline reporting stays on the legacy Quillon tools through year-end, and territory reassignments are frozen. Budget overruns will be absorbed by deferring the Ashgate office refresh. No commission changes this cycle. Strategic background for the delay appears below.

confidential, kagup-bafog: Fraaxax Group is in early talks to buy Soroxox Group for about $343.8 million. The Olidor launch date is June 14, and nothing goes to the press before then. Legal wants the Aldmirek Logistics term sheet signed before July 23.

## Runbook: InvoPress PDF Renderer — Release Steps

Support: when a new InvoPress build ships, invoice PDFs may render with updated fonts and margins; this is expected for about an hour while caches refresh. If customers report blank invoices, check the renderer health page before escalating. Releases are staged to the Corvel cluster first, then promoted. Every promoted build is signature-verified by the render nodes, so confirm the build was signed with the key shown below.

signing key of bagap-yawep = bky13_TbfT6ZMUoGJo2

UserSplit Cutover Drift: the extracted account service and the legacy Marigold monolith user module are reporting divergent record counts during dual-write. This fires when drift exceeds 0.5% over 15 minutes. New team members should not replay writes manually. Reconciliation steps and the rollback procedure are documented on the internal page.

wiki page, tajog-fafog: https://gitlab.paliqsys.corp/dash/display/job/853dd6fcbf54